  • Overview

    Qualitative interviews offer rich opportunities to explore people's lived experiences, emotions and perspectives with depth and nuance.

    This accessible and practical guide equips researchers with innovative techniques to enhance interview-based research. From incorporating objects, documents and sensory prompts to choosing the optimal interview format – plus drawing inspiration from fields like therapy and journalism – the book introduces creative strategies for generating more meaningful, credible data that centres the participant in every interaction.

    Key features include:

    • Support for researchers to deepen dialogue, connection and participant empowerment;

    • Emphasis on the co-production of meaning, emotional and reflective engagement and authentic research encounters; and

    • Insights and case studies from contemporary methods and lessons across diverse disciplines.

    Ideal for postgraduate students, early career researchers and practitioners, this book demonstrates how to design interviews that are not only ethically grounded but also genuinely engaging, facilitating richer, multimodal and culturally sensitive qualitative research.
